From 832914452a9638b713a3ea9a490cbc18f3b164f2 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Sean Christopherson Date: Thu, 2 Jul 2020 19:35:30 -0700 Subject: [PATCH] KVM: x86/mmu: Move fast_page_fault() call above mmu_topup_memory_caches() Avoid refilling the memory caches and potentially slow reclaim/swap when handling a fast page fault, which does not need to allocate any new objects.
